Most owners assume that putting a fountain for pond use into the water means hiring a crew, booking a truck, and losing a week in that installation. That is rarely the case with smaller floating units. If your pond runs under an acre and you have an outlet within reach of the bank, the whole job fits comfortably inside a Saturday afternoon. Assembly takes less time than anchoring, and anchoring takes less time than deciding where the unit should actually sit.
So the real question is not whether you can install a fountain for pond aeration on your own. It is which units are built for a homeowner to install and which ones are not. Anything running on 120 volts and light enough for two people to lift belongs in the first group.
What Makes a Fountain for Pond Setup a One-Day Job
Voltage decides most of this. A 120-volt unit plugs into a GFCI outlet or a supplied control box, and that connection completes the electrical work. A 208-240-volt unit is hardwired at the motor, and that part belongs to an electrician.
The rest of the install stays the same either way. You assemble, you float, you anchor, you plug in.
Weight matters too. Smaller floats and their nozzle assemblies move around by hand or on a small boat. Larger horsepower units get heavy fast, and dragging one across a bank alone is how people damage the housing before the pump ever runs.

Measure the Pond Before You Buy, Not After
Here is why this order matters. Cable length is fixed at the time of purchase. Pond depth is fixed by nature. If either one comes up short, the box goes back and your weekend goes with it.
Three numbers cover it:
- Distance from the outlet to the spot where the fountain will float
- Water depth at that spot, taken with a weighted line rather than guessed
- Surface area, which sets the flow rate you should be shopping for
Most floats need a minimum depth to sit level and keep the intake off the bottom. Set one shallow, and it draws silt, which clogs the screen and dulls the spray within days.

Building the Float on Dry Ground
Do the assembly on the grass, not at the water’s edge. Lay out the parts, check them against the manual, and finish before anything gets muddy.
Nozzle heads usually thread or clip onto the pump housing. Some units ship with two or three interchangeable patterns, so this is the moment to pick one rather than swapping heads later while balancing on a boat.
Cable routing gets sorted here as well. Free the power cord from the coil, straighten it, and lay it out along the bank in the direction it will run. The coiled cable holds its twist and pulls the float off-center once the pump starts.
Anchoring So the Fountain Stays Where You Put It
Two anchoring methods cover almost every pond, and the choice depends on width.
Shoreline tethering works on narrow water. You run lines from the float to two or three points on the bank and adjust until the unit sits where you want it. Setup takes minutes. Adjustment afterward takes minutes too, which is the real advantage.

Bottom anchoring suits wider ponds. Weights sit on the bed and hold the float up against the wind, with enough slack in the lines to allow for water level changes. Cinder blocks handle this well enough for most residential ponds.
Leave slack. A tight line pulls the float under on the first heavy rain, and people forget that ponds rise.
Power, the Outlet and the Cable Run
Plug into a GFCI outlet. If the nearest one is too far from the water, that is a job for an electrician before install day rather than something to be solved with extension cords on the afternoon itself.
Run the cable where mowers and foot traffic will not find it. Along a fence line, under mulch, or through conduit if the run crosses open ground. Perhaps overkill for a short distance, though cable damage is the most common reason these units fail early.
When the Afternoon Turns Into Something Bigger
Some installs are honestly not weekend work. Ponds over an acre, units above one or two horsepower, and any pond without power near the bank all move into a different category.
Lighting adds a little time, though not much. LED kits mount at the float and connect during the same setup, so adding them on install day beats having to pull the unit back out in a month.
Wrapping Up
The next steps are simple. Measure the run to your outlet, sound the depth where you want the fountain, then buy against those two numbers. Do that and the afternoon really is just assembly, anchoring, and a plug.
